2011-06-02 59 views
0

我被要求研究开发一个非常简单的黑莓应用程序,打开时基本上在本机浏览器中打开一个URL。一个简单的黑莓应用程序,打开一个URL

我看到有两种方法开发黑莓应用程序; Java和Web(Javascript)。我发现打开URL的示例代码是这样的:

Browser.getDefaultSession().displayPage(URL); 

这是Java版本。有没有Javascript版本?我可以使用Javascript制作黑莓应用程序吗?

开发/发布这种类型的应用程序最简单的方法是什么?我不想超越顶端,除非需要安装Eclipse IDE等。

另外,我在Mac上开发,但如果需要可以访问Windows计算机。

+0

你的最简单的方法将成为一个URL应用程序:这里是文章:http://supportforums.blackberry.com/t5/Web-and-WebWorks-Development/How-to-Create-a-URL-launching-application-for-BlackBerry/ta- p/1164027 – 2012-09-06 19:40:26

回答

0

有WebWorks的,这是他们的框架,使用JavaScript编写的应用程序:

http://www.blackberry.com/developers/docs/webworks/api/index.html

它本质上是一个BrowserField小部件和一些脚手架允许的Javascript调用到Java代码一个荣耀的Java应用程序。您也许能够做这样的事情来改变您的位置:

window.location = "http://www.google.com/" 

我不知道那的WebWorks比编写Java代码整体更容易,但有选择至少

+0

这将浪费空间堆积巨大的WebWorks应用程序只是为了做location.href =“xxx” – 2012-09-06 16:18:48